Moby-Dick

In Moby-Dick, sailor Ishmael tells the story of Captain Ahab and the white whale, Moby Dick. Ahab, the grizzled captain of the whaling boat the Pequod, searches for Moby Dick across the oceans of the world in a single-minded pursuit. Ishmael joins the crew of the Pequod, a whaling ship helmed by Captain Ahab. There, he befriends a fellow shipmate, the harpooner Queequeg. Captain Ahab reveals that the white whale, Moby Dick, once bit off his leg. As the Pequod traverses the whaling grounds, Ahab continuously seeks information from other boats as to the white whale's location. In a deadly confrontation with Moby Dick, the entire crew of the Pequod is killed, except for Ishmael, who lives to tell the story.
